Deformations of Symplectic Foliations: algebraic aspects

Symplectic Geometry 2023-05-02 v1 Quantum Algebra

Abstract

In the companion paper arXiv:2110.05298, we developed the deformation theory of symplectic foliations, focusing on geometric aspects. Here, we address some algebraic questions that arose naturally. We show that the LL_{\infty}-algebra constructed there is independent of the choices made, and we prove that the gauge equivalence of Maurer-Cartan elements corresponds to the equivalence by isotopies of symplectic foliations.
